Overall Meaning

Shannon Noll's song This Is It speaks about embracing the present moment and taking control of our lives. There are no signs or clear paths for us to follow, but we must trust in our abilities to make the most of what we have now. The lyrics suggest that we need to let go of our fear of making mistakes and take risks because life is going to move forward regardless. All we have is the present, and it's up to us to decide whether we fall or make it.


Noll's lyrics encourage listeners to live in the present moment and make the most of what we have. He reminds us that everyone makes mistakes, but we shouldn't let that fear stop us from taking a chance. The line "everybody dies, but not everybody lives" highlights the importance of living life to the fullest and taking risks that may lead to greater fulfillment. The lyrics also emphasize the power of our actions in the current moment, rather than dwelling on the past or worrying about the future.
